Steal the Show: Insider Hacks for Creating Unforgettable Expo Tabletops

Trade shows and expos are high-stakes environments. You've invested time, money, and effort into your product or service – now it's time to make it shine. But with countless booths vying for attention, how do you ensure yours is unforgettable? The answer lies in crafting a captivating expo tabletop display that grabs attention and drives engagement. This article reveals insider hacks to help you steal the show.

Beyond the Basics: Designing a Standout Expo Tabletop

Forget the standard banner and brochure setup. To truly stand out, your expo tabletop needs a strategic design that incorporates several key elements:

1. The Power of Visual Storytelling:

Your tabletop isn't just about showcasing your logo; it's about telling a story. What problem do you solve? What makes you unique? Use visuals – high-quality images, compelling videos, even interactive elements – to communicate your message instantly and memorably. Think less text, more impact.

Pro Tip: Use a cohesive color scheme that aligns with your branding. A well-designed color palette can significantly enhance visual appeal and brand recognition.

2. Interactive Elements: Engage, Don't Just Display:

Static displays are boring. Incorporate interactive elements to keep visitors engaged and encourage interaction. Consider:

  • Product demonstrations: Let visitors experience your product firsthand.
  • Interactive games or quizzes: Offer a fun way to learn more about your brand.
  • Touchscreen displays: Showcase videos, product information, and customer testimonials.
  • Contests and giveaways: Incentivize engagement and collect valuable leads.

Pro Tip: Consider the flow of traffic around your booth and strategically place interactive elements to maximize engagement opportunities.

3. Strategic Use of Lighting:

Lighting can dramatically impact the perceived quality and appeal of your expo tabletop. Use strategically placed lighting to highlight key features of your display and create a warm, inviting atmosphere. Avoid harsh, overhead lighting that can wash out colors and create glare.

Pro Tip: Invest in high-quality LED lighting for energy efficiency and a professional look.

4. High-Quality Print Materials:

While digital elements are crucial, don't underestimate the power of well-designed print materials. Use high-quality brochures, flyers, and business cards that reflect your brand's professionalism and sophistication.

Pro Tip: Choose materials that are durable and easy to handle. Avoid flimsy paper that can easily crease or tear.

Pre-Show Prep: Setting Yourself Up for Success

Planning is key to a successful expo. Before the show, take these steps:

1. Set Clear Goals and Metrics:

What do you hope to achieve at the expo? Define specific, measurable goals, such as the number of leads generated or the number of product demonstrations conducted. This will help you track your success and make improvements for future events.

2. Practice Your Pitch:

Your team needs to be prepared to engage visitors effectively. Practice your pitch and ensure everyone is comfortable discussing your product or service and answering common questions.

3. Gather Necessary Materials:

Make a checklist of all the materials you'll need, including signage, brochures, giveaways, and any necessary technological equipment. Ensure everything is packed securely and easily accessible.

Beyond the Booth: Maximizing Your Expo Impact

Your efforts shouldn't end at the tabletop. Consider these off-site strategies to amplify your expo presence:

1. Pre-Show Marketing:

Promote your expo participation through email marketing, social media, and your website. This will help generate excitement and attract potential visitors to your booth.

2. Post-Show Follow-Up:

Don't let the leads collected at the expo go cold. Immediately follow up with each contact to nurture relationships and convert them into customers.

3. Analyze and Improve:

After the expo, analyze your results against your pre-defined goals. What worked well? What could be improved? Use this feedback to enhance your strategy for future events.
